The authors need to reference recent work by Adame on constrained polymer effects. >2. The authors also need to look at work on ion-dipole interactions with clay by Goss etal. >3. The x-ray diffraction patterns have been misinterpreted both systems are intercalated. >4. The TEM pictures also show an intercalated system not exfoliated. >5. The intercalate in the above the isoelectric point are interacting through ion-dipole bonding and below via electrostatic. > >Additional Questions: >Please rate the overall importance of this manuscript to the field of biomacromolecules (10 ¨C High Importance/ 1 ¨C Low Importance): 5 > >Please rate the element of novelty in the research reported (10 - High Novelty / 1 - Low Novelty): 5 > >Please rate the interest to scientists working in the field of biomacromolecules (10 - High Interest / 1 - Low Interest): 6 > >Please rate the focus of the manuscript on the interface of polymer science and the biological sciences (10 - High Focus / 1 - Low Focus): 6 > >Are the conclusions adequately supported by the data presented?: No > >Are any compounds reported adequately characterized?: No Reviewer: 2 > >Recommendation: Publish after minor revisions noted. > >Comments: >This is a carefully written paper on a topic of interest to the readers of Biomacromolecules and is suitable for publication with only minor changes. > >-The intensity in the cross polarization spectrum is not always quantitative. The authors should justify their use of this approach. >-MMT is paramagnetic. How does this affect the results? Could this affect the quantitative relationship in signal intensity for those signals nearest the clay? >-Silk is renown for its mechanical properties. The authors may wish to comment on the possibility of using the clay-silk interactions to prepare films or fibers for mechanical testing. This is probably not possible with the lyophilized material as prepared here. > > >Additional Questions: >Please rate the overall importance of this manuscript to the field of biomacromolecules (10 ¨C High Importance/ 1 ¨C Low Importance): 8 > >Please rate the element of novelty in the research reported (10 - High Novelty / 1 - Low Novelty): 9 > >Please rate the interest to scientists working in the field of biomacromolecules (10 - High Interest / 1 - Low Interest): 9 > >Please rate the focus of the manuscript on the interface of polymer science and the biological sciences (10 - High Focus / 1 - Low Focus): 8 > >Are the conclusions adequately supported by the data presented?: Yes > >Are any compounds reported adequately characterized?: Yes |
